In 1957, Mother Jerome Schmidt, prioress of
the Benedictine Sisters of the Sacred Heart
Monastery in Yankton, South Dakota, announced
the foundation of the Mother of God
Daughterhouse in Pierre, South Dakota. The first
members of this new foundation moved to Pierre
in 1961. The community moved to Watertown, South
Dakota, in 1967. In 2001, the Sisters celebrated
their fortieth anniversary as an independent
monastery.

In 1879, Benedictine Sisters from
Pennsylvania founded the Community of Saint
Joseph Monastery in Creston, Iowa. In 1889, the
Sisters began teaching in Guthrie, Oklahoma
Territory. In 1892, the Motherhouse was moved to
Guthrie. In 1955, the Motherhouse was
re-established in Tulsa, Oklahoma.
